Maintenance Playbook
Book a pump every 3 years for typical households; shorten the interval with large families or disposal use. Space laundry loads, avoid bleach-heavy cleaners, and keep wipes out of the system.
Divert roof runoff away from the drain field. Maintain grass cover, avoid heavy vehicles, and flag lids so service is swift. Store permits and past reports for a complete history.

Your drain field may be buried, but it is the core of the system. We coach Poinsett County AR owners to protect it by keeping grass cover, moving roof water, and stopping heavy loads. If absorption slows, we treat laterals, rebalance dosing, and monitor recovery before suggesting replacement.
